| Job | Typical price |
|---|---|
| Mini valet / maintenance wash | £26–£34 |
| Full valet | £60–£84 |
| Interior-only valet | £30–£45 |
| Machine polish / stage-1 correction | £110–£180 |
| Ceramic coating | from £210 |
| Maintenance plan (monthly, per visit) | from £23 |
| Local going rates from our regional price model. The BL3 holder sets their own prices — we never touch the money. | |
